Obesity May Increase Risk of Prostate Cancer


Obesity is the condition of having an accumulation of body fat that results in a person being 20 percent over the highest acceptable standard for normal weight according to age and height. Those who suffer from obesity are at an increased risk for many health problems including, but not limited to, cardiovascular disease, hypertension, high cholesterol, and, for men, prostate cancer. Some researchers have found links between obesity and the occurrence of prostate cancer. High risk of prostate cancer may occur due to the way fat fuels the production of testosterone which fuels the growth of prostate cells and possibly prostate cancer.
